There are three types around.
The two factory ones are velour and flat knit.
Flat knit I’ve seen on VY VZ VE VF.

I think velour was on pre VY.
My VP had velour which has a slight soft feel/fluffy texture.

Flat knit you can see the weave in the fabric.

Then faux macro suede which my fav.
